Obviously, a few folks thought I was only showing the ends of a huge horseshoe magnet, but that is not the case. You are seeing two magnets that attached themselves to a metal bar, which was hung from a ladder. You can barely see the lines of the metal bar in the photo. These are fairly small, but powerful magnets. Anyway, thanks to all for your great comments and votes. |
